It all started with the internet, the one that accelerated society in a shorter time than any other technology in history. Then came the cloud that enabled the ever-present, on-demand access to a shared pool of computing resources. Now we have aPaaS that enables users to build applications on the cloud faster and cheaper than other alternatives. Let’s dig deeper into understanding these digital transformation approaches, learn what is the difference between aPaaS vs IaaS vs PaaS vs SaaS.
aPaaS or Application Platform as a Service is a category of cloud-based software that provides a platform for users to develop, deploy and manage applications without the complexity of building and maintaining the infrastructure typically associated with developing and launching an application. It provides subscribers with the hardware, operating systems, storage, or network capacity for developing new applications.
PaaS or Platform as a Service refers to any cloud-based middleware, including BPM, messaging apps, and other tools while aPaaS refers specifically to PaaS platforms specialized in cloud-based application development. It is best to think of aPaaS as a subcategory of PaaS.
A little more detailed comparison:
Key features include:
Also read: Everything you should know about no-code development
Application platform as a service enables rapid application development and delivery. Many PaaS providers streamline different aspects of application provisioning and deployment but don’t address the slowness of developing applications. The right aPaaS brings automation to the complete application lifecycle, providing a faster way to build apps with fewer resources compared to traditional methods.
Also read: A Comprehensive Glossary of Digital Transformation Terms
Pricing models vary among providers. Many use the number of apps or users to set a monthly fee. Platforms like Quixy also provide a free version, empowering individuals and organizations to test the development platform.
When it comes to crafting digital marvels, Application Platform as a Service (aPaaS) gives developers the ultimate paintbrush. It handles all the nitty-gritty of infrastructure, so they can focus purely on creating amazing apps. Meanwhile, Infrastructure as a Service (IaaS) hands developers a virtual playground where they can build anything from the ground up, handling the blocks and the building.
Think of Application Platform as a Service (aPaaS) as a tailor-made studio for app artisans. It’s all about creating and refining apps with ease. Platform as a Service (PaaS), on the other hand, is like a bustling marketplace offering the studio and various tools and materials, making the entire app-making journey smoother.
Application Platform as a Service (aPaaS) is like giving you a magical wand to conjure custom apps into reality. It’s a canvas where your app dreams take shape. In contrast, Software as a Service (SaaS) is like entering a ready-to-go wonderland, where you can use existing software without needing to worry about installation or upkeep.
Imagine Infrastructure as a Service (IaaS) as a DIY construction site. You get the land, materials, and tools to build your own structures. Platform as a Service (PaaS) is like a creative studio where you can craft something unique but with added conveniences like tools, blueprints, and a supportive community.
Infrastructure as a Service (IaaS) hands you the keys to a virtual world where you’re the master of your domain – you build, configure, and maintain. Software as a Service (SaaS), however, is like entering a grand feast, where you savor the dishes but leave the cooking and cleanup to someone else.
Platform as a Service (PaaS) is like a collaboration space for app developers, providing not only tools but also the ideal environment to shape your creations. Software as a Service (SaaS) is akin to a ready-made buffet – you simply enjoy the dishes without worrying about the recipes or cooking process.
Quixy’s application platform as a service empowers business users with no coding skills to build unlimited enterprise-grade applications, using simple drag and drop design, 10X faster using 60% fewer resources compared to the traditional approach, consequently enhancing efficiency, transparency, and productivity of business operations.
The platform includes an integrated cloud database, a visual application builder, enterprise-grade security, regulatory compliance, and scalable global infrastructure. Don’t miss out on the chance to elevate your processes. Take the first step and get started with Quixy today.
aPaaS (Application Platform as a Service) provides a cloud-based environment for developing, deploying, and managing applications without managing the underlying infrastructure. It offers development tools, pre-built services, and runtime environments to simplify the application development process.
Development tools (low-code/no-code options)
Pre-built services (databases, APIs, security features)
Runtime environments for application deployment
Integration capabilities with other cloud services
Faster application development
Reduced development costs
Increased agility and scalability
Easier application management
Improved collaboration among developers
Yes, definitely. Built for scalability, aPaaS platforms like Quixy can adapt to growing user bases and data. Look for features like auto-scaling and resource optimization to ensure your enterprise app runs smoothly under heavy loads.
Yes. Most aPaaS platforms offer robust security features like data encryption, access controls, and compliance certifications to ensure the security of your business applications.
aPaaS excels at building web applications for businesses. This includes CRM systems, internal portals, workflow tools, and customer-facing applications like e-commerce platforms or booking systems.
Cloud services come in flavors! Here’s a quick breakdown:
IaaS (Infrastructure): Rent the building blocks – servers, storage, networking – to build your own IT environment. Think Legos for developers.
PaaS (Platform): Get a pre-built development platform with tools and services. Like a pre-fab house, faster to set up for app development.
aPaaS (Application): Focuses specifically on building applications. Think a kitchen appliance suite – it helps you cook up specific web apps.
SaaS (Software): Access ready-made software applications you use through a web browser, like renting a furnished apartment – no setup needed!